Both PWP and PS are excellent and both have features that aren't quite
duplicated by the other.
An astro imaging software package you might want to look into is
ImagesPlus. I think it's a terrific deal and has a ton of features.
The author also supports the software strongly. In the 6 months I've
owned it I think there have been 3 updates, each with many more new
features. See http://www.mlunsold.com/
I also think that most, if not all, of the functions handle 16 bit
images. It has a large selection of deconvolution options.
Mike (the author) responds to all requests for help and suggestions
for improvement or new features. The CD comes with great video
tutorials that really seem to shorten the learning curve.
And compared to PS, it's quite a bargain. There is also an active
Yahoo mail list for ImagesPlus: ImagesPlus@yahoogroups.com
